[slide-carousel] {
  width: 100%;
  overflow: hidden; }
  [slide-carousel] [slide-carousel-images] {
    -webkit-transition: 1s;
            transition: 1s;
    margin: 0;
    padding: 0; }
    [slide-carousel] [slide-carousel-images] li {
      list-style: none;
      margin: 0;
      padding: 0; }
    [slide-carousel] [slide-carousel-images] li {
      display: inline-block;
      white-space: nowrap; }
    [slide-carousel] [slide-carousel-images] img {
      width: 100%; }
  [slide-carousel] .links {
    text-align: center; }
    [slide-carousel] .links ul, [slide-carousel] .links li {
      list-style: none;
      margin: 0;
      padding: 0; }
    [slide-carousel] .links li {
      display: inline-block; }
    [slide-carousel] .links a {
      -webkit-transition: 0.5s;
              transition: 0.5s;
      display: inline-block;
      color: black;
      text-decoration: none;
      margin: 5px;
      border-radius: 100px;
      border: 2px solid white;
      width: 5px;
      height: 5px;
      color: transparent; }
    [slide-carousel] .links a:hover, [slide-carousel] .links a.selected {
      background: red; }
